What is the difference between the Music talent area, the Music Elective Programme (MEP), and the Performing Arts talent areas?
Music, Performing Arts (PA) and Visual Arts are talent areas under RI's DSA-Sec Performing Arts & Visual Arts domain. Their differences are as follows:
For Music, successful applicants are required to join the Music Elective Programme (MEP). There is no requirement to join a music-related CCA.
For Visual Arts, successful applicants are required to join the RI-Art Elective Programme (RI-AEP). There is no requirement to join a related CCA.
For Performing Arts, successful applicants are required to join the CCA of the talent area which they have been accepted in from Year 1-4. The PA CCAs are Chinese Orchestra, Choir, Concert Band, and String Ensemble.
